MSC MERAVIGLIA to sail from Southampton in summer 2027

MSC MERAVIGLIA to sail from Southampton in summer 2027

6th October 2025 at 9:21 am

MSC Cruises has announced that MSC Meraviglia will sail from Southampton from 18th May to 30th October 2027. She will offer 19 sailings ranging from 6 to 14 nights, visiting new destinations such as Ibiza, Gibraltar and Tangier in Morocco, as well as favourites such as the Canary Islands, Lisbon, Malaga and the Norwegian Fjords.

Passenger numbers soared to record levels in September at Cork and Dublin airports

Passenger numbers soared to record levels in September at Cork and Dublin airports

3rd October 2025 at 8:24 am

A record-breaking summer at Cork and Dublin airports continued in September with a total of 3,667,073 passengers passing through the two airports.

IAA publishes final decision on Dublin Airport’s Summer 2026 Capacity

IAA publishes final decision on Dublin Airport’s Summer 2026 Capacity

2nd October 2025 at 1:12 pm

The Irish Aviation Authority (IAA) has published its final decision on Dublin Airport’s Summer 2026 capacity which will be used in the airport slot allocation process. The final decision remains consistent with the proposals of the draft decision.
